Our 4th grade T.R.E.K. students turned into young detectives during an exciting fingerprint analysis lab! Using cocoa powder, lotion, and a brush, they explored the science behind lifting and identifying fingerprints. We love seeing their curiosity and critical thinking in action!

April is Occupational Therapy Month, and the 2025 theme is Inspiring Hope, Changing Lives. Across PCSSD, OTs inspire hope & change lives by helping students develop skills they need in the classroom, like fine & gross motor skills, sensory processing & more. #pcssdproud #serveall
